Photo of two separate portrait photographs of Ralph Henry Combs wearing a suit and tie.

He was married to Charlotte (Morrison) Combs (1928-2013). Together, the couple raised four children.

Ralph worked at the Woodstock Garage for many years.

Photograph of Laco Lee Dellinger with his wife and two sons.

Identified (l to r) are: Jeff Dellinger, Laco Lee Dellinger, Ellen (Hockman) Dellinger, and Steve Dellinger.

The family lived in the Edinburg area.
